Come with me on this 10-day expedition to Mount Elbrus (5642 meters) and climb the highest peak in Europe!
This 10-day program offers the possibility of ascending one of the Seven Summits. Located in the Caucasus mountains, near the border with Georgia, Mount Elbrus is one of the most beautiful mountains in the world.
The route I have chosen is quite easy, and it will be a great opportunity for climbers to learn more about acclimatization techniques, which will be essential for those who wish to climb higher mountains in the future. We will be climbing Elbrus along with Ivan, a local IFMGA-certified guide, who knows this mountain like the back of his hand.
Take into account, however, that Mount Elbrus should not be underestimated at all. Uncertain weather conditions make the company of a guide essential.
I will be happy to safely guide you during the entire ascent and make sure you have an experience of a lifetime. Keep in mind that this famous mountain can be climbed and descended on foot or or on skis.
